It was a night of decision wins at the indoor sports hall of the National Stadium in Surulere, Lagos as boxing enthusiasts witnessed an electrifying showcase of skills and determination at the Judgment Day event on February 24.
In the One2 Sports Promotions main event, Muritador Monyasahu faced off against Ambrose Godwin for the vacant National Cruiserweight title.
After 10 grueling rounds of back-and-forth action, Monyasahu emerged victorious, securing the title with a resounding unanimous decision (93-97, 98-92, 90-100) to the delight of the spectators.
In the first fight of the evening, featherweights Ojo Arabambi and Mojeed Gbolahan engaged in a fierce battle, with Arabambi ultimately clinching a hard-fought victory by split decision (77-73, 75-77, 77-75) after eight rounds of action-packed combat.
Next up, the crowd was treated to an exhilarating super-lightweight clash between Hammed Ganiyu and Hakeem Olayiwola. Ganiyu’s dominance was on full display as he dropped Olayiwola in the fourth round on his way to claiming a commanding unanimous decision victory (70-80, 72-79, 73-78) after eight rounds.
In another thrilling showdown, Kazeem “The Killer” Lawal squared off against Ganiyu Kolawole in a super-welterweight clash. Lawal showcased his prowess in the ring, securing a decisive victory by unanimous decision (55-59, 54-60, 58-56) after six hard-fought rounds.
The action-packed night continued with a middleweight clash between Christian Abua and Jubril Olalekan. Abua displayed his skill and determination, outclassing Olalekan to claim victory by unanimous decision (60-54, 58-56, 64-70) after six thrilling rounds of combat.
Welterweights Oluwasegun Mustapha and Isiaka Raheem also squared off in a highly anticipated matchup and Mustapha delivered a stellar performance, defeating Raheem by a unanimous decision after six rounds of intense exchanges.
